Oxycodone addiction treatment begins with providing a safe, controlled environment for the user to effectively detox from the drug. Most of the time, Oxycodone detox will take place in a residential facility where medical staff can provide around-the-clock monitoring of vitals and overall health of the patient to ensure safety. Some people find it easier to detox in a residential setting simply because there is more support and medical care available and there is no need to focus on other aspects of life when in a residential setting.
Some places provide what is called rapid opiate detox but these methods are not approved by most doctors for the treatment of Oxycodone addiction and should be avoided whenever possible. Rapid Oxycodone treatment such as Rapid Detox is not safe and it can leave you in a dangerous state of mind or health.
Getting off Oxycodone is a difficult process that takes time, commitment and your own free will. Even the most strong willed individuals who want to stop using Oxycodone sometimes have difficulty quitting when they have become addiction. Oxycodone treatment is an effective way of helping those who are addicted to get off Oxycodone and return to a somewhat normal state of life post addiction.
Treatment Options
You will have various treatment options when you decide to stop using Oxycodone. First, you could quit cold turkey and go for the gusto but for many, this method leads to failure and doesn’t really work. Unfortunately, Oxycodone addiction is characterized by painful and difficult to cope with withdrawal symptoms that make quitting a difficult process. Your attempts to quit cold turkey and without professional help are likely to fail simply because of the strength that Oxycodone addiction has over a user.
Fortunately, there are other treatment options available to you and most of them have been proven to be more effective than simply quitting cold turkey. For instance, you can go into a residential treatment program that will provide you with around-the-clock support, counseling and therapy as well as healthy meals and a place to live. This is the ideal choice for Oxycodone treatment but you have other options available as well such as:
- Outpatient treatment
- Medication maintenance therapy
- Sober living
